A recent glitch has drawn sharp criticism from the gaming community after two players shared experiences of escaping matches with five generators still functioning. Many players suspect a new bugโ€”or worse, a potential cheatโ€”could undermine gameplay integrity.

What Happened?

In the game's latest recent matches, players discovered they could escape by climbing a short boundary wall before fulfilling game objectives. One comment summarized the situation: "Dude figured out he could just climb the 3-foot edge wall and leave. Entity is in shambles." This revelation has triggered a flood of discussions on forums.

Community Reactions

Commenters expressed a mix of disbelief and frustration, questioning the effectiveness of current anti-cheat systems. "I donโ€™t know how this actually gets past the anti-cheat," one user stated, suggesting a simple script could ban players who escape too early. Other users echoed similar sentiments, including a notable remark:

"Cheaters spend time modding a game so they can immediately end the game. Geniuses, clearly."

The dialogue escalated with contributors suggesting solutions. One user highlighted:

"Not only that, the game analytics track when gens complete. Maybe give everybody a couple freebies but if you do it 5+ times? Maybe look closer at that guy, eh?"
